Minutes — Management Meeting, Licensing Dispute

Attendees reviewed the ongoing dispute with Quillhaven Media over the Aster Engine license. Counsel advised that arbitration is likely to conclude within two quarters. Finance should reserve against a possible settlement and hold the disputed royalty payments in escrow pending resolution. Rowan Pelt will circulate updated exposure estimates next week. The board's position on settlement strategy is recorded below.

confidential, yagep-kagef: Rusvanox Holdings is in early talks to buy Julwynix Systems for about $454.5 million. The Fenael launch date is April 23, and nothing goes to the press before then. Legal wants the Druwynix Works term sheet redrafted before January 8.

Subject: Retention sweeper live on Quillbrook prod

Team — the Quillbrook data-retention sweeper shipped in tonight's release. It purges records older than 400 days from the archive tier, hourly. On-call: watch purge-rate alerts for the first 24h; page Marisol if deletions exceed 2% of tier volume. Rollback flag is sweeper_enabled. Verified against the build below.

trace token, kahog-tajeg: htk6_97d963

## Changelog — DiffScope 4.2.1 (key rotation)

This release rotates the signing key for DiffScope, our large-file diff viewer, following the scheduled annual rotation. No functional changes are included. Verification of 4.2.0 and earlier continues to work via the archived key in the trust bundle. All artifacts from 4.2.1 onward, including the streaming-chunk renderer, are signed with the new key below.

release key, fahop-bahip: bky19_PspfQHRyvVcYD9LdZgo

Subject: Quickstore 4.2 — bloom filter now fronts the KV layer

Plugin authors: starting with this release, Quickstore places a bloom filter ahead of the key-value store. Negative lookups return faster; false positives fall through safely. No API changes are required on your side. Verify your plugin against the staging build referenced below.

session token of fahif-tadup = htk3_9c7